Aspose.pdffor.net:开发者必备的PDF工具库
在当今数字化时代,PDF文档已成为信息交换与存储的重要格式。对于.NET平台的开发者而言,如何高效、灵活地处理PDF文件,成为了提升应用价值与用户体验的关键。Aspose.pdffor.net,作为一款专为.NET开发者设计的PDF工具库,凭借其强大的功能集、简洁的API设计以及卓越的性能表现,正逐渐成为开发者们不可或缺的得力助手。
一、Aspose.pdffor.net概述
Aspose.pdffor.net是Aspose公司针对.NET框架开发的一款高性能PDF处理组件。它不仅支持创建、编辑、转换PDF文件,还提供了丰富的文档操作功能,如添加注释、数字签名、表单填充等。无论是构建企业级文档管理系统,还是开发需要频繁处理PDF的应用程序,Aspose.pdffor.net都能提供全面而高效的解决方案。
二、核心功能亮点
1. PDF创建与编辑:从空白文档开始,或基于现有模板,轻松创建PDF文件。同时,支持对现有PDF进行文本编辑、图像插入、页面重组等操作,满足多样化的文档处理需求。
2. 格式转换:无缝实现PDF与其他多种格式(如Word、Excel、HTML、图片等)之间的相互转换,保留原始布局与样式,确保数据完整性与可读性。
3. 表单处理:自动识别并填充PDF表单字段,支持静态与动态表单元素,简化数据收集与报告生成流程。
4. 安全性控制:提供加密、数字签名、权限设置等功能,保护PDF文档免受未授权访问与篡改,确保信息安全。
5. 高性能与稳定性:针对.NET平台深度优化,即使在处理大型PDF文件时也能保持流畅的性能,减少系统资源消耗,提升应用响应速度。
三、易用的API设计
Aspose.pdffor.net的API设计遵循直观、简洁的原则,即使是初学者也能快速上手。通过丰富的类库与方法,开发者可以轻松实现复杂的PDF操作,而无需深入了解PDF文件的内部结构。此外,详细的文档与示例代码进一步降低了学习成本,加速了开发进程。
四、应用场景广泛
- 企业文档管理:自动化PDF文档的生成、分类、存储与检索,提高文档管理效率。
- 报表生成:结合数据库数据,动态生成格式化的PDF报表,支持图表、表格等复杂元素。
- 电子签名系统:集成数字签名功能,实现合同、协议等文件的远程签署与验证。
- 内容转换服务:为网站、APP等提供PDF转Word、HTML等格式的服务,增强用户互动体验。
- 表单自动化:自动化处理大量PDF表单,如调查问卷、申请表等,提升数据处理效率。
五、实战案例分享
以某企业文档管理系统为例,该系统需处理海量PDF文件,包括创建、编辑、转换及归档等功能。引入Aspose.pdffor.net后,开发团队利用其强大的API,快速实现了以下功能:
- 批量PDF生成:根据数据库记录,自动生成标准化的PDF报告,大大节省了人工编写时间。
- 表单自动填充:员工提交的电子表单自动转换为PDF,并填充到指定位置,提高了数据录入的准确性与效率。
- 文档转换服务:为用户提供PDF转Word功能,便于文档的二次编辑与分享。
- 安全控制:对敏感文档实施加密与访问权限控制,确保数据安全。
六、总结与展望
Aspose.pdffor.net以其全面的功能、高效的性能以及友好的开发体验,成为了.NET开发者处理PDF文档的首选工具。随着技术的不断进步与市场的日益成熟,Aspose.pdffor.net将继续深化其在PDF处理领域的优势,为开发者提供更多创新、便捷的功能,助力企业数字化转型与升级。对于正在寻找强大PDF处理解决方案的.NET开发者而言,Aspose.pdffor.net无疑是一个值得深入探索与长期依赖的伙伴。